About Us
VeraPulse Media is an independent digital publication devoted to original fiction about ordinary people, everyday places, and the small situations that can become unexpectedly complicated.
Our stories often begin with something simple: a broken elevator, a misplaced suitcase, a difficult shift at work, a neighborhood disagreement, a mistake, a routine that stops working, or a conversation that takes an unexpected direction.
We are interested in the details that usually go unnoticed — the habits people develop, the compromises they make, the frustrations they rarely explain, and the practical ways they deal with one another.
What We Publish
VeraPulse Media publishes original fictional stories written and edited for this website.
Our stories are not news reports, journalism, or accounts presented as verified real-world events. Characters, dialogue, situations, timelines, and other narrative elements may be invented, adapted, combined, or altered for storytelling purposes.
Some stories may begin with an ordinary observation, memory, place, profession, conversation, or experience from everyday life. From there, the narrative is developed as fiction. When an author’s or editor’s note appears with a story, it may provide additional context about the observation or idea that prompted it.
The aim is not to make fiction appear factual. It is to write believable fiction grounded in recognizable human behavior and everyday life.
How We Approach Our Stories
We prefer specific details to exaggerated drama.
That means our stories do not need extraordinary heroes, perfect endings, or convenient twists. A disagreement may remain partly unresolved. A person may make the wrong decision for understandable reasons. A small improvement may matter more than a dramatic transformation.
We pay particular attention to setting, dialogue, work, routines, objects, and the practical details of how people actually move through their day.
Before publication, stories are reviewed and edited for clarity, coherence, readability, and consistency. We also revise material that feels repetitive, unnecessarily sensational, or disconnected from the rest of the narrative.

Why VeraPulse Media Exists
There is plenty of room online for the spectacular. We are more interested in what happens before and after it — and sometimes in days when nothing spectacular happens at all.
A chair that was never returned. A nine-minute traffic problem. A bakery opening before sunrise. Neighbors dealing with a broken elevator. A teacher noticing something he had previously misunderstood.
These situations are small enough to be overlooked, but large enough to reveal how people work, argue, adapt, misunderstand one another, and occasionally change their minds.
That is the territory VeraPulse Media is interested in exploring.
